Crime overview

Craddocks Close area has the 6th highest crime rate of 38 local areas in Ashtead Lanes & Common , and the 69th highest crime rate of 251 local areas in Mole Valley .

Compared with the surrounding streets, this postcode does not stand out as either a particular hotspot or an unusually safe pocket. Crime levels in the neighbouring output areas are broadly in line with this area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Craddocks Close (KT21 1AF) in the last 12 months was 67.6 per 1,000 residents and was 99.1% higher than the Ashtead Lanes & Common average (34.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 17 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 20 (≈ 46.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 33.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-16.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Craddocks Close (KT21 1AF), the main crime hotspot is near Old Stede Close. Police recorded 9 crimes here, including 7 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
